# Links table

> Read the Links table: URL, status, anchor, target, GI, DR, DA, SS, EFL, LQS, last checked, and details.

The Links page (`/links`) is the full list of URLs you monitor. Click **Add links** to submit more. Select rows for [bulk actions](/article/bulk-actions).

## Columns

| Column           | What it shows                                                                                                                   |
| ---------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| **URL**          | The page Ples checks                                                                                                            |
| **Status**       | Dofollow, Nofollow, Not Found, Error, or Waiting — see [Link statuses](/article/link-statuses)                                  |
| **Anchor**       | Anchor text found on the page                                                                                                   |
| **Target URL**   | The href Ples found (labeled **Target** in the table)                                                                           |
| **GI**           | Google indexing: indexed, not indexed, or unknown                                                                               |
| **DR**           | Domain Rating (Ahrefs-style metric, with logo)                                                                                  |
| **DA**           | Domain Authority from Moz                                                                                                       |
| **SS**           | Spam score from Moz                                                                                                             |
| **EFL**          | External dofollow count on the linking page                                                                                     |
| **LQS**          | Link Quality Score, 0–100                                                                                                       |
| **Last Checked** | When Ples last checked the URL (header **Chkd**). Dates look like July 15, 2025                                                 |
| **Created**      | When you added the row — shown in [link details](/article/link-details) as **Date added**, and available as a date-added filter |

Click a URL to open [link details](/article/link-details). Hover **EFL** for external nofollow and internal counts. Hover **LQS**, **GI**, **DR**, **DA**, and **SS** for the metric name.
